WebThe descriptive statistics examples are given as follows: Suppose the marks of students belonging to class A are {70, 85, 90, 65) and class B are {60, 40, 89, 96}. Then the average marks of each class can be given by the mean as 77.5 and 71.25. This denotes that the average of class A is more than class B. WebSolved by verified expert. 1. Descriptive statistics is used to describe and summarize data. It focuses on providing a detailed summary of the data, such as the mean, median, mode, range, and standard deviation. Inferential statistics uses sample data to make predictions and draw conclusions about a population. WebFor two continuous variables, a scatterplot is a common graph. When one variable is categorical and the other continuous, a box plot is common and when both are …

WebMar 20, 2024 · ANOVA (Analysis of Variance) is a statistical test used to analyze the difference between the means of more than two groups. A two-way ANOVA is used to estimate how the mean of a quantitative variable changes according to the levels of two categorical variables. Use a two-way ANOVA when you want to know how two …
